在用户操作和应用程序响应之间总是会出现延迟.

A delay will always occur between a user action and an application response.

众所周知,响应延迟越低,应用程序瞬间响应的感觉就越大.众所周知,高达 100 毫秒的延迟通常是不可感知的.但是 110 毫秒的延迟呢?

It is well known that the lower the response delay, the greater the feeling of the application responding instantaneously. It is also commonly known that a delay of up to 100ms is generally not perceivable. But what about a delay of 110ms?

可以感知的最短应用响应延迟是多少?

What is the shortest application response delay that can be perceived?

我对任何确凿的证据、一般的想法和意见感兴趣.

I'm interested in any solid evidence, general thoughts and opinions.

推荐答案

我记得了解到的是,键入字母后出现超过 1/10 秒 (100 毫秒) 的任何延迟都会开始对生产力产生负面影响(例如,您本能地放慢了速度,不太确定您是否输入正确),但低于该水平的延迟生产力基本上持平.

What I remember learning was that any latency of more than 1/10th of a second (100ms) for the appearance of letters after typing them begins to negatively impact productivity (you instinctively slow down, less sure you have typed correctly, for example), but that below that level of latency productivity is essentially flat.

鉴于这种描述,不到 100 毫秒的延迟可能会感知,因为它不是瞬时的(例如,训练有素的棒球裁判可能可以解析两个事件的顺序,甚至比 100 毫秒更近),但它足够快,可以被视为对反馈的即时响应,就对生产力的影响而言.100 毫秒及以上的延迟绝对是可察觉的,即使它仍然相当快.

Given that description, it's possible that a latency of less than 100ms might be perceivable as not being instantaneous (for example, trained baseball umpires can probably resolve the order of two events even closer together than 100ms), but it is fast enough to be considered an immediate response for feedback, as far as effects on productivity. A latency of 100ms and greater is definitely perceivable, even if it's still reasonably fast.

这是针对已收到特定输入的视觉反馈.然后在请求的操作中会有一个响应标准.如果您单击表单按钮,在 100 毫秒内获得该单击的视觉反馈(例如,该按钮显示压抑"外观)仍然是理想的,但在此之后您预计会发生其他事情.如果一两秒内什么都没有发生,正如其他人所说,你真的想知道它是否接受了点击或忽略了它,因此当操作可能需要超过一秒钟时显示某种工作......"指示器的标准在显示清晰效果之前(例如,等待弹出新窗口).

That's for visual feedback that a specific input has been received. Then there'd be a standard of responsiveness in a requested operation. If you click on a form button, getting visual feedback of that click (eg. the button displays a "depressed" look) within 100ms is still ideal, but after that you expect something else to happen. If nothing happens within a second or two, as others have said, you really wonder if it took the click or ignored it, thus the standard of displaying some sort of "working..." indicator when an operation might take more than a second before showing a clear effect (eg. waiting for a new window to pop up).
